BMW Art Car Collection premieres online with video tour

Mon, 11 Jul 2011

The BMW Art Car Collection has made a global debut on the Internet, with a virtual video tour that gives an overview of each car and outlines the collection's development since 1975. Photo and video content are included in the tour for each of the 17 art cars, at www.bmw-artcartour.com. "Whilst the originals are often exhibited individually at the BMW Museum in Munich or at significant cultural institutions throughout the world, people are now able to discover the BMW Art Cars in their entirety," BMW spokesman Bill McAndrews said.

Lamborghini Gallardo production ends as its replacement is trailed

Wed, 27 Nov 2013

No sooner has the death knell finished tolling for the now departed Lamborghini Gallardo – the firm’s best-selling model ever – the Italian supercar manufacturer is already teasing the Gallardo’s replacement. On a new website – Hexagonproject.com – Lambo is revealing "the roar of its new creature," which is thought to be called the Cabrera. 'Gran Turismo' pays tribute to Senna with 'Ayrton's Wish'

Fri, 02 May 2014

Back in October, "Gran Turismo" announced a partnership with the Ayrton Senna Institute. We're finally starting to see the fruits of that labor -- a Senna-edition Playstation 3 bundle in Brazil notwithstanding. The first element of a month-long tribute from publisher Polyphony Digital is the above 20-minute film, "Ayrton's Wish." Two months before Imola, Ayrton told his sister Viviane that he wanted to give back to the country that so idolized him.
